Torabhaig Taigh
The Tasting Notes
Seaside embers and flint smoke are balanced by earthy woodland notes, evoking an autumnal forest walk. Baked apple pie, maple syrup, and gentle raisin richness emerge, alongside a touch of clove, cinnamon spice, and a hint of cereal biscuit.
Light to medium-bodied, with soft smoke wrapped in vanilla custard, toasted almond and sweet dried fruits, all carried on a smooth, oily texture.
Gentle yet spirited, with toasted oak and a sprightly touch of tannin. Lingering vanilla and red fruits mingle with cinnamon and clove spice, before settling into a persistent, pleasant smoke that rounds it off with both warmth and approachability.
Details
Torabhaig Taigh is the first core expression from Torabhaig Distillery, representing the distillery’s signature house style described as ‘Smoke with Taste’.
This single malt Scotch whisky is matured in a combination of first fill bourbon barrels, refill bourbon casks and select Madeira casks. The use of first fill bourbon casks supports the development of sweetness and structure, while refill casks allow the distillery character to remain at the forefront. The inclusion of Madeira casks adds an additional layer of influence during maturation.
Produced using gently peated spirit, this release reflects a balanced and approachable style from the Isle of Skye distillery.
Bottled at 46% ABV, Torabhaig Taigh is presented without chill-filtration or added colouring.
